Yes, winter is hard on bikes. Particularly because of salt, it's best to wash down your bike regularly, and that's not easy in the winter when you can't use an outdoor hose. The best alternative, which some friends have but I don't, is an indoor heated space such as a laundry room that has a floor drain. I have heard of people bringing their bikes into the shower, but I only have a stall shower and it's on the top floor, whereas the bikes enter and exit through the basement, so that isn't happening. I simply fill buckets of water and pour them over the bike outside my garage (but positioned so that the water doesn't coat my driveway and give me sheets of refreeze.
